In-Depth Analysis of “MATTEL”

History and Background

Founded in 1945, Mattel is a pioneering toy company with a vast portfolio. Its products are designed to appeal to a broad demographic, making it a prime candidate for the crossword clue.

Key Products

  • Barbie dolls
  • Hot Wheels cars
  • Fisher-Price educational toys
  • American Girl dolls

Market Position

Mattel operates worldwide, with manufacturing and distribution channels spanning continents, making it a household name for toys for boys and girls alike.
